Geoje P.O.W. Camp Historic Park is a park and exhibition hall built on the site of South Korea's largest prisoner-of-war camp, which accommodated up to 173,000 North Korean and Chinese prisoners captured by the South Korean and UN forces during the Korean War (1950-1953). Visitors to the exhibition hall can learn about the Korean War and the lives of prisoners through educational displays and experiences, as well as view war artifacts such as weapons.

Baekmanseok is a renowned restaurant on Geojedo Island specializing in a local delicacy called meongge bibimbap (sea pineapple bibimbap), which is a dish made of sea pineapple mixed with laver, sesame seeds, and sesame oil, renowned for its exquisite taste. The menu also includes options like ganjang gejang jeongsik (soy sauce marinated crab set menu), seongge bibimbap (sea urchin bibimbap), and saeng ureong maeuntang (spicy rockfish stew). Additionally, side dishes such as spicy fish stew, marinated crab, and grilled fish are served. Nearby attractions include the Geoje P.O.W. Camp Historic Park and the Geoje Tour Monorail.

Danghangpo Tourist Site Pension is a two-story wooden house in Goseong-gun, Gyeongsangnam-do. Guestrooms are ondol-style and consist of a kitchen/living room, a sleeping room, a bathroom, and a terrace. You can cook in the kitchen, but please use the terrace for meat and seafood. Pension guests get a free pass to all Danghangpo Tourist Site facilities, which include a dinosaur footprint fossil hall, a hologram video hall, a botanic garden, and a turtle ship experience - all very popular with the children!

Bijindo Beach is a unique coastal area with the sea on both sides. One side features a sandy white beach, while the other side offers a small pebble beach. The beach boasts a spectacular view of both sunrise and sunset. Additionally, it is a habitat for the natural monument paperplant (Fatsia japonica).

Bijindo Island is located 13 kilometers from Tongyeonghang Port. The island's main attraction is the 550-meter-long beach. Due to the unique formation of the island, with the beach appearing to connect two separate islands, it is possible to view both the sunrise and the sunset from the beach. The western side is a sandy beach, while the eastern side is a pebble beach.
Visitors to the island can also enjoy scenic attractions of Hallyeohaesang National Park, including Haegeumgang Island and Sipjaedonggul Cave. Bijindo Island is also a great place to enjoy seafishing or simply relax in the natural beauty.

Ssanggeun Auto Campground, located near Ssanggeun Port, features a total of sixteen camping sites equipped with facilities such as showers, restrooms, and sinks. A caretaker is on-site to ensure safety, with fire extinguishers and fire hoses available. Conveniently, a market just five minutes away provides firewood, camping, and fishing supplies. In addition to camping, visitors can enjoy sea bathing, fishing, and tidal flat experiences at the beachfront right in front of the campground.
